Q1: What role does a non-return valve play in a vacuum pump system?

A: A non-return valve is a critical safety component in vacuum systems, primarily designed to prevent the reverse flow of media during pump shutdown or pressure fluctuations. Without an NRV, external air or process media can flow back into the pump, leading to contamination, equipment damage, or system failure. SJ VALVE's non-return valves feature an intelligent design that ensures automatic closure upon pump stoppage, maintaining vacuum integrity, reducing restart load on the pump, and extending equipment service life.


Q2: What are the core technological innovations of the SJ VALVE non-return valve series?

A: The newly launched valves incorporate a compact, modular design, constructed from stainless steel or aluminum alloy to balance corrosion resistance and lightweight needs. Key innovations include:

  • Low-Leakage Sealing: Utilizes specialized elastomeric sealing materials to achieve near-zero leakage when closed.
  • Fast Response Mechanism: An optimized spring and disc dynamic design ensures millisecond-level response to pressure changes, preventing backflow shock.
  • Broad Compatibility: Standardized connections (ISO, ANSI) allow for easy integration with most mainstream vacuum pump models, supporting both horizontal and vertical installation.

Q4: How is long-term reliability and stability ensured?

A: SJ VALVE emphasizes maintainability and durability through a modular internal design, allowing for quick disassembly, cleaning, and seal replacement without specialized tools. Additionally, the valves undergo rigorous testing:

  • Cycle Fatigue Testing: Simulates over 100,000 open/close cycles to verify spring and disc reliability.
  • Extreme Environment Testing: Validates material performance under high temperatures (up to 150°C) and corrosive atmospheres.
  • Third-Party Certification: Selected models carry ATEX certification for use in hazardous environments.
